Supervisory Responsibilities

  • Hiring, training, managing, evaluating, disciplining, and terminating all Nurses and Medication Assistants.
  • Determines adequate staffing levels and prepares staffing schedules using approved tools.
  • Replaces absent Team Members as required per resident care and facility needs.
  • Ensures proper training and certification of all Nurses and Medication Assistants as required by Merrill Gardens and state and local guidelines.
  • Mentors Team Members using electronic care system.
  • Supervises Nurses and Medication Assistants to evaluate performance on an ongoing basis to ensure residents receive appropriate care.
  • Provides staff in-service training, as indicated by the facility and resident needs, to ensure Team Members have received training necessary to accomplish their assignments and provide accurate resident care.

Administration

  • Adheres to budgetary guidelines established by Merrill Gardens.
  • Provides General Manager with weekly status reports on all AL residents.
  • Maintains all resident records and department documentation.
  • Audits AL services for regulatory compliance.
  • Reviews and verifies all Nurses and Medication Assistants are using the time clock appropriately and taking breaks as indicated by policy and regulations.
  • Responds quickly to all emergency situations, including but not limited to: assisting in fire control and resident evacuation procedures during fire/disaster, ensuring care personnel know actions to be taken during fire/disaster, performing CPR as necessary.
  • Maintains continuing education requirements when necessary for state licensing/registration.
  • Provides additional management reports as required.
  • Ensures the AL work area, which may include offices, medication rooms, etc., are clean and orderly.

Qualifications

  • Education: Current RN licensure, as specified by state agency, preferred. Bachelor’s Degree or equivalent.
  • Experience: 3-years related experience, training, or equivalent combination of education and experience. Experience in Assisted Living, geriatric nursing, or gerontology and dementia care. Experience in medication administration and hands-on personal care preferred. Demonstrated ability in budgeting and cost control.
